Lehavim () is an affluent town in southern . Founded in 1983 and located in the northern around 15 km north of , it is a local council. In it had a population of .


History
Lehavim, originally called "Givat Lahav," covers an area of 2,525 (2.5 km2). It is one of 's three satellite towns (the others are Omer and ). Most of the inhabitants commute to Beersheba for work. Lehavim is an upper-middle class community of detached homes surrounded by palm trees and gardens. As of 2017, it received the highest ranking on the Israeli Socio-Economic Index (10 out of 10) Socio Economy cbs.gov.il according to the Israel Central Bureau of Statistics along with only three other municipalities (Omer, and ). The town has a library, a country club, kindergartens, a school, two synagogues, and a commercial center. Lehavim achieved a municipal status in 1988.


Transportation
Lehavim is located near the intersection of Highway 40 () and Highway 31 (Arad–), known as the Lehavim Junction. The Lod–Beersheba railway line passes through this crossing.
